CVE-2013-5987

NVD · uneditedUnspecified vulnerability in NVIDIA graphics driver Release 331, 325, 319, 310, and 304 allows local users to bypass intended access restrictions for the GPU and gain privileges via unknown vectors.

dbcve analysis · moderate confidenceNVIDIA graphics driver for Windows contains a local privilege escalation vulnerability affecting versions 304, 310, 319, 325, and 331. Local attackers can bypass intended GPU access restrictions to gain elevated privileges through unknown vectors related to GPU driver interactions.

Check NVIDIA driver version in WindowsOpen NVIDIA Control Panel, go to 'System Information' or right-click on Desktop and select 'NVIDIA Control Panel' > 'System Information'. Record the driver version shown (e.g., 304.00, 310.00, 319.00, 325.00, or 331.00).Affected if The displayed driver version exactly matches 304.xx, 310.xx, 319.xx, 325.xx, or 331.xx (these are the vulnerable versions).
-
Verify driver version via Device ManagerOpen Device Manager, expand 'Display adapters', right-click on the NVIDIA GPU device, select 'Properties', go to the 'Driver' tab, and note the driver version string.Affected if The driver version shown is one of the affected versions: 304.xx, 310.xx, 319.xx, 325.xx, or 331.xx.
-
Check NVIDIA driver version via command lineOpen Command Prompt and run 'nvidia-smi' if available, or check the registry key 'HKLM\SYSTEM\CurrentControlSet\Services\nvlddmkm\DriverVersion'.Affected if The version retrieved from nvidia-smi or the registry matches 304.xx, 310.xx, 319.xx, 325.xx, or 331.xx.
-
Confirm system has NVIDIA GPU hardwareOpen Device Manager under 'Display adapters' and verify an NVIDIA GPU is present and actively installed.Affected if An NVIDIA GPU is installed and the associated driver version is one of the vulnerable versions listed.
A system is affected if it runs any NVIDIA graphics driver version 304.xx, 310.xx, 319.xx, 325.xx, or 331.xx on Windows with an active NVIDIA GPU.

From vendor dataUpdate NVIDIA graphics drivers to versions newer than the affected releases (331, 325, 319, 310, 304). Apply the latest stable driver version from NVIDIA's official download page, prioritizing systems with direct GPU access.
